Version 2.7.0sk
- - Added Color Matrix.
- Added Hue-Saturation filter from GIMP. Almost an exact C→HLSL translation.
- Removed ASCII Art filter, the implementation is really bad and it's better to just get rid of the whole thing until I can come up with something better.
- Removed Dot Matrix, it was a bad filter.
- Removed RetroFX suite. For a long time, I've been trying to figure out how to fix a strange bug causing incorrect colours with almost all palettes. As it turns out, the problem isn't on my code, but rather on the way fragment shaders work in Direct3D, and how anything just slightly "too complex" for it will result in inexplicable, unexpected behaviour. Simply put, I'm fed up with all the constant debugging for finding a way to make Microsoft's braindead graphics API do what I want it to. Something like RetroFX would be much more consistent and predictable in an image editor than here.
- Full migration to volume map LUTs. All old 2D texture based modes have been removed. There really is no reason to keep them around when the new way™ is much simpler and precise.

Version 2.6.0sk
- - Reduced the frost overlay a bit.
- Implemented true 3D LUTs, now that I just discovered ENB can load volume maps. MariENB is now the very first preset to ever use 3D textures.
- Ported old screen dirt filter from ancient MariENB.
- Brought back some recently removed filters now that the technique limit has been raised.
- Added edge detect and linevision.
- Added custom fog w/ limbo mode.
- Set custom SSAO back to 64 samples, the performance hit is abysmal (50% FPS drop), but the quality is vastly improved. Considering it was never meant for normal gameplay, this is fine.
- Added "shift" parameter to SSAO to see if that helps reduce the excess darkening.
- Other tweaks I may have missed.
